Miniature golf scores for a group of friends follows:
30, 32, 36, 40, 44, 45, 46, 48, 55, 58, 59, 60, 76, 82, 90
Which measure of variability—IQR or MAD—best describes the spread of the dataset? Enter 1 for IQR or 2 for MAD.

1
Q1 = 40, Q3 = 60 → IQR = 20.
Median = 48 → absolute deviations: 18,16,12,8,4,3,2,0,7,10,11,12,28,34,42 → MAD = median = 11.
Because the scores are right-skewed with high outliers, the IQR (robust measure of central spread) better describes the dataset.
